Putin Acknowledges Economic Problems Due to Excessive Military Spending
MAYRIN GUTIERREZ ROMERO
In a surprising statement, Russian President Vladimir Putin admitted that the heavy military expenditure is negatively impacting the country’s economy. During a recent speech, Putin pointed out that massive investment in defense has created financial pressures that could limit long-term economic growth.
The leader emphasized the need to balance national priorities, stating that while security is essential, it is also crucial to ensure economic stability and social welfare. Analysts interpret this admission as a possible shift in Russia’s economic policy, with a more cautious approach to the military budget.
This revelation has sparked various reactions both inside Russia and internationally, where observers are closely watching how Moscow will adjust its strategies to face these economic challenges without compromising its military power.
